What is the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

The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ire is a formal document used by tenants to inform their landlords of their intention to vacate a nonresidential property at the end of a specified lease term. This notice serves as a legal communication that outlines the tenant's decision to terminate the lease agreement, ensuring that both parties are aware of the upcoming vacancy. It is essential for maintaining clear communication and avoiding potential disputes regarding the lease's termination.

Key elements of the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

When preparing the Notice Of Intent To Vacate, several key elements must be included to ensure its validity:

  • Tenant Information: Full name and contact details of the tenant.
  • Property Details: Address of the nonresidential property being vacated.
  • Lease Information: Reference to the lease agreement, including the start and end dates.
  • Intent to Vacate: A clear statement indicating the tenant's intention to vacate the premises.
  • Vacate Date: The specific date when the tenant plans to leave the property.
  • Signature: The tenant's signature, which validates the notice.

Steps to complete the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

Completing the Notice Of Intent To Vacate involves several straightforward steps:

  1. Gather necessary information, including the lease agreement and tenant details.
  2. Fill in the tenant's name, contact information, and the property address.
  3. Include the lease start and end dates, along with a clear statement of intent to vacate.
  4. Specify the date the tenant plans to vacate the property.
  5. Sign the document to confirm its authenticity.
  6. Deliver the notice to the landlord, ensuring it is done within any required notice period.

Legal use of the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

The legal use of this notice is critical in protecting both the tenant's and landlord's rights. By providing a formal notification, the tenant fulfills their obligation under the lease agreement to inform the landlord of their intent to vacate. This notice can be used as evidence in case of disputes regarding the lease termination. It is important that the notice complies with New Hampshire state laws regarding lease terminations to ensure it is legally binding.

How to use the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

Using the Notice Of Intent To Vacate effectively requires understanding its purpose and the proper procedure for submission. Once the notice is completed, it should be delivered to the landlord in a manner that provides proof of receipt, such as certified mail or in-person delivery. Retaining a copy of the notice for personal records is also advisable. This documentation can be crucial if any issues arise after the notice has been submitted.

State-specific rules for the Notice Of Intent To Vacate At End Of Specified Lease Term From Tenant To Landlord Nonresidential New Hampshire

In New Hampshire, specific rules govern the notice period and the manner in which the Notice Of Intent To Vacate must be delivered. Typically, tenants are required to provide at least thirty days' notice before the lease term ends. It is essential to check local regulations or the lease agreement for any additional requirements that may apply. Understanding these rules helps ensure compliance and protects the tenant's rights throughout the process.
